
President Muhammadu Buhari and the National Chairman of the All
Progressives Congress (APC), Adams Oshiomhole on Friday met behind
closed doors at the Presidential Villa, Abuja.
Oshiomhole speaking with State House correspondents after the
meeting, said that the party’s campaign for the 2019 presidential
election will focus on character and integrity of the candidates.
According to him, “We are fully ready, we have done with our
primaries and filled our nominations. As you know, INEC still has a
window between now and First of January to deal with issues of
substitution. As of campaigns, we are ready.
“We are going to announce the date and programme for our campaigns,
and speak to the issues. My idea of kick off will be the day we will do
our first presidential rally where Mr. President as our candidate and
other candidates, party leaders will assemble in a venue that will be
agreeable to all of us.
“There will be two sets of messages. One, on what we have done in the
past, without failing to remind people of where we were before, what we
are going to do in the next three years, and a couple of things we
believe we will be doing differently.
“Why we are a better choice? President Buhari if compared to the rest
of the aspirants, there is no basis to compare day and night. The real
issue in this election is not going to be religion. It is not going to
be about political party, central to the issue and given our past
experience as a country, we know that what makes a difference is the
character, the issue of integrity of the candidates.
“All those issues of character, especially looking at the past, the
key candidates in the election are not strangers to governance, they are
not even strangers to this villa, so we will be able to ask a couple of
questions about what do they know now that they didn’t know then when
they had power.
“This edition is going to be focusing on character, integrity of
those who want to govern us. In addition to what and how they will do
things differently.” he said
